Rowling Internet has been on of the most important events in the history of the human being, It has modified every aspect of our lives, and it has affected people from every ages, since the youngers, to the elders. Naturally, Social media has been a boon for the people, there are connections from every parts of the Word and the opportunities are everywhere. However, those benefits are not for everybody, not everyone can take advantage of that; only responsible people can do it. Because, inside the internet, there are many dangers. This essay will argue about that teenager under thirteen should not have access to the social networks because it is dangerous, they have no the enough responsibility and they have no the enough control of their time. First of all, it is danger. The main reason why the social media is danger is because teenager can get in touch with any unknown. You as a parent, you would not like your children talk with other adults secretly because you are conscious of many cases where a child were cheated or kidnaped by an adult. For instance, in the 2017 in Colombia the police registered 280 cases of “grooming” (RCN RADIO), that is the crime of when an adult convinces a child through a social network to get erotic material. Another reason why the social media is danger for kids is the hazard of harmful tendencies. For example, in Colombia around one thousand people played “the game of the blue whale”. That was a game who foster the childs to harm themselves, and last instance, to commit suicide. For the last for the two previous reasons you have considered that leaving the kids alone in the social media is a danger habit. The second point is that kids have no the enough responsibility to respond by their actions in the social network because the decision of posting something in media is very serious; if you post something in the media, everybody is going to see it, and once done, there is no turning back because someone could take a screenshot and save it. For instance, the above mentioned implies that the children are exposed to be bullied by something they post and they did not realized that information could have been used against ther. On the other hand, kids may post something that they regret in the future. For instance, some naughtiness photos they post could affect their future work life. To sum up, child under 13 are not prepared to analyze each risk of post something in the media, and they could be not prepared for the consequences like being cyberbullied, or losing a future job. The last point is that teenager lose many time in the media. Facebook, Twitter and Instagram are distractors especially if teenager have them in their cell-phones. This point could affect their academic life; they could be spending more time in the media than doing their homework. For instance, according to CNN, the adolescents in the United States spent an average of nine hours per day using the media and that is more of the time they spent in school. On the other hand, if teenagers spend too much time in the social networking, the spent less with their family and friends. this could deteriorate relationships to the children of parents. For those two reason is important that parents control the access of their children to the social media. To conclude, By themselves, the social networks are not beneficial or harmful, there are just a tool. The problem are the people who are inside that media. This does not mean that the people who use the social media is bad; this means that through media, kids are exposed to many risk. To sum up, the main risk are that inside the media, there could be dangerous people; the kids could post thing they could regret and finally, they could being be wasting many unrecoverable hours of their life.
